Are there any recommended alternatives to using PHP for generating and updating graphs, such as Flash or other technologies?
One recommended alternative to using PHP for generating and updating graphs is to use JavaScript libraries such as D3.js or Chart.js. These libraries offer more interactive and visually appealing options for creating graphs on web pages. By incorporating these libraries into your code, you can easily generate and update graphs without relying solely on PHP.
// Instead of using PHP to generate graphs, you can use JavaScript libraries like Chart.js
// Here is an example of how you can create a simple bar graph using Chart.js
<!DOCTYPE html>
<html>
<head>
<title>Bar Graph Example</title>
<script src="https://cdn.jsdelivr.net/npm/chart.js"></script>
</head>
<body>
<canvas id="myChart" width="400" height="400"></canvas>
<script>
var ctx = document.getElementById('myChart').getContext('2d');
var myChart = new Chart(ctx, {
type: 'bar',
data: {
labels: ['January', 'February', 'March', 'April', 'May'],
datasets: [{
label: 'Sales',
data: [12, 19, 3, 5, 2],
backgroundColor: 'rgba(255, 99, 132, 0.2)',
borderColor: 'rgba(255, 99, 132, 1)',
borderWidth: 1
}]
},
options: {
scales: {
y: {
beginAtZero: true
}
}
}
});
</script>
</body>
</html>
Related Questions
- How can CSS properties like text-transform affect the display of text in different browsers when using PHP templates?
- Is setting fields to UNIQUE in a database the best practice to prevent multiple profiles in PHP?
- What are some best practices for streamlining and optimizing array manipulation in PHP when dealing with database query results?